Why Multi-Sport Athletes Need Speed Training in Tulsa
Playing multiple sports challenges the body in different ways. Soccer requires sprint endurance, basketball emphasizes quick cuts, and baseball demands explosive first steps. Without proper training, athletes may struggle to keep pace with the demands of each sport.
Speed training for athletes in Tulsa helps multi-sport competitors adapt. By focusing on mechanics, strength, and conditioning, athletes can perform at a high level year-round.
It also reduces burnout and injuries by preparing the body to handle the varied stresses of multiple sports.
Key Elements of Speed Training for Multi-Sport Athletes
A well-rounded program in Tulsa focuses on multiple areas:
Sprint Mechanics
Proper running form builds efficiency. Athletes who refine stride length, posture, and arm drive carry speed into every sport.
Agility Development
Quick direction changes are essential in basketball, soccer, and football. Agility ladders and cone drills improve lateral speed and body control.
Strength Training
Explosive lower-body strength fuels acceleration. Bodyweight movements, plyometrics, and resistance training are crucial for athletes who juggle multiple seasons.
Conditioning
Different sports demand different energy systems. Interval training helps athletes maintain speed in soccer while also preparing for fast bursts in baseball or basketball.

Balancing Training Across Sports Seasons
Multi-sport athletes must train smart. Speed training in Tulsa should adjust with each season. For example:
-
Pre-season: Focus on conditioning and sprint mechanics.
-
In-season: Maintain speed with lighter drills and recovery work.
-
Off-season: Build strength and explosive power for future seasons.
This balanced approach ensures athletes stay fast without overtraining.

Tips for Multi-Sport Athletes Doing Speed Training
-
Listen to your body. Rest when needed to avoid overuse injuries.
-
Stay consistent. Even short weekly sessions maintain speed.
-
Adjust intensity. Train harder in the off-season and lighter during the season.
-
Track progress. Measure sprint times and agility improvements across sports.
-
Work with a coach. Professional guidance ensures proper technique and balance.
These tips help athletes maximize results without sacrificing performance in any sport.
